[–] 0 pt

At the base there is a magnet that gets a current while the ball is headed for the center, this pulls the ball. Then the current is cut until the ball reaches its zenith and heads back, at which time the current is reapplied. Effectively dragging the ball toward the canter, allowing it to gain momentum while "falling" I guess you would call it.
